Kevin D. Osborn is an Adjunct Associate Professor at the University of Maryland's Laboratory for Physical Sciences. His research focuses on superconducting circuits, quantum information science, and reversible computing. He leads the KDO Research Group, which explores quantum defects in superconducting qubits and topological fluxon-based logic gates for energy-efficient computing. His work includes developing novel quantum systems, such as defect lasers and fluxon logic, to address challenges in quantum coherence and computational efficiency.
Osborn has mentored graduate students like Chih-Chiao Hung and Tim Kohler, and has collaborated on projects funded by the Simons Foundation. His teaching includes a course on superconducting devices and circuits, covering topics like Josephson junctions, quantum algorithms, and superconducting material properties. Key research areas include cavity quantum electrodynamics (C-QED), two-level system (TLS) spectroscopy, and the application of topological particles in reversible computing.
Recent advancements include demonstrating a random-defect laser using TLSs and proposing energy-efficient CNOT gates using fluxons. His group also studies material interfaces and surface engineering to improve superconducting resonator performance. Osborn's contributions span experimental and theoretical work, with publications in Physical Review Letters, Applied Physics Letters, and others.
